    • Table 1. Main indicators of MIRUS

      View table

      Table 1. Main indicators of MIRUS

      CharacteristicPerformance
      Wavelength /nm670‒780
      Full width at half-maximum (FWHM) /nm0.3
      Width of swath /km20
      GSD /(km×km)0.1×0.1 (non-binning), 0.2×0.2 (binning)
      Smile /nm0.02
      Keystone /nm0.02
      Signal-to-noise ratio (SNR)200@10 mW·m-2·sr-1·nm-1
    • Table 2. Overall performance parameters of optical system

      View table

      Table 2. Overall performance parameters of optical system

      Optical parameterPerformance
      Wavelength /nm670‒780
      F#2
      Focal /mm321
      Pixel size /μm24
      Field of view (FOV) /(°)2.29
      Convex grating frequency /mm-11524.4
      Size /(mm×mm×mm)673×621×231
